Lafayette Avenue Coffee Strip

Fort Greene's coffee corridor along Lafayette Avenue: a mix of long-tenure neighborhood cafés and newer specialty bars within a few blocks of Fort Greene Park.

Lafayette Avenue between South Oxford Street and Vanderbilt is the unofficial coffee row of Fort Greene. Within a handful of blocks you pass a rotating cast of independent neighborhood spots, with Fort Greene Park itself a central point. The strip's character is set by foot traffic from the BAM cultural campus and the brownstone residential blocks on either side.
